Out of all the cars that I have ever owned, my 2009 Honda Accord is my favorite one by farI truly enjoy driving this car every single day. Some of my favorite things about it are the sleek and attractive design, how comfortable, luxurious, and smooth the ride is, the great gas mileage, and the dependability. People are constantly complimenting me on how nice the interior is and I love how it handles on the road. To me, the car feels solid too. The engine always sounds strong and starts right up and the interior doesn't feel cheap or seem to wear out quickly. The seats are comfortable, even for longer commutes or road trips. The only two downsides that I have found to this car are limited storage space and no four wheel or all wheel drive options. I think Honda could improve the Accord if they made the seats fold down flatter to accommodate larger items in the trunk and added the option of all wheel drive. The price is another downside, as it is higher than other midsize cars in the same class. Honda vehicles seem to hold their resale value relatively well, however, and I think the value exceeds the cost of the car. Overall, I am very pleased with this car and will most likely buy another one in the future.

I have 2009 Honda Accord and had to replace the rear brake pads for 3 times within the 3 years of owning this car, Apparently, this is a manufacturing defect and there are lots of complaints on this. I have owned 3 Hondas and bought for the quality but, not any more, this will be the last Honda for me.
